Demographics details for Mainesburg, PA vs Yuma, AZ

Population Overview

Compare main population characteristics in Mainesburg, PA vs Yuma, AZ.

Data Mainesburg Yuma
Population 279 98,527
Median Age 36.0 years 32.0 years
Median Income $55,000 $59,312
Married Families 50.0% 39.0%
Poverty Level 10% 18%
Unemployment Rate 4.0 9.0

Population Comparison: Mainesburg vs Yuma

  • The population in Yuma is higher at 98,527, compared to 279 in Mainesburg.
  • Residents in Mainesburg have a higher median age of 36.0 years compared to 32.0 years in Yuma.
  • Yuma has a higher median income of $59,312, compared to $55,000 in Mainesburg.
  • A higher percentage of married families is found in Mainesburg at 50.0% compared to 39.0% in Yuma.
  • The poverty level is higher in Yuma at 18%, compared to 10% in Mainesburg.
  • Yuma has a higher unemployment rate at 9.0% compared to 4.0% in Mainesburg.
